When Adolf Hitler is sending you combat forces to help you win a civil war, it's a pretty good sign that you're not a nice guy.
Franco came to power by launching a coup that became a bloody civil war, which killed as many as a half a million people. Once in power, he imposed a dictatorship, and murdered between 15,000 and 50,000 political opponents.
Sometimes a dictatorship, while evil, creates the stability needed to improve economic conditions. Not in Spain. A con-man convinced Franco that he could get plenty of oil by combining river water with herbs and secret powders. And the dictator was persuaded to overcome widespread starvation in the 1940s by feeding the population of 30 million with...dolphin sandwiches. He also cut off almost all international trade, and the economy stagnated.
It's difficult to find much positive to say, but it is true that the state he overthrew was both militant, bloody, and inept, and it's true that the most likely alternative, had Franco lost, would have been a leftist revolution, sponsored by the USSR. (So, Hitler is arming one side, and Stalin is arming the other). Spain had a democratic constitution between 1931 and 1938, but once the civil war was underway, those fighting on the left made it clear that their goal was a Communist state, not a continuation of the existing democratic government.
The new socialist government had also imposed drastic restrictions on any religious activity, confiscated church property, closing schools run by the church, and making it illegal for brothers and nuns to teach. Those fighting on the Republican (leftist) side went further, murdering hundreds of priests and nuns.
Franco's victory in the civil war did end those killings, and bring some stability, as well as a return to "traditional values", but, as noted, it also brought more political killings, and decades of economic stagnation. You could argue, though, that the alternative, based on the track record of the old government and it's more left wing allies, would have been worse. Likewise, you could argue that Franco's record of social programs and human rights, awful as it was, was likely better than the Stalinist state which was the most likely alternative.
